front upper camber plate

anyone know if there are any front upper camber plate for 01 ex? i have the kw v2, but go autox alot so it will be much easier if i hve a front upper camber plate, and if so how much??

See if the Hotchkis RSX ones fit. They're like $450. Other than that, its JIC or Tein Flex coils. Ground control makes a set, but you need to use their coilovers, no idea on price of those
